Bioform Technologies is a Canadian materials science company based in Vancouver, British Columbia, developing bio-based alternatives to single-use plastics. Its patented process manufactures multilayered, pulp fibre reinforced hydrogels at commercial speeds, using feedstocks of wood pulp fibre and kelp combined with a salt-based catalyst in an extrusion printing process similar to papermaking. Layers are printed with high water content and then pressed to a target moisture level: higher water content yields softer, flexible films, while lower water content produces more rigid material suitable for items such as lids and trays, after which the product is molded to shape.

The company produces both compostable, heat-sealable films and paper-recyclable thermoforming films. Stated applications include rigid packaging, pouches, agricultural mulch film, garbage bags, disposable food utensils and consumer packaging such as bottles. Bioform states its materials require no fossil-based inputs, can be home compostable or recycled through existing paper recycling streams, and offer roughly an 80% lower carbon footprint than conventional single-use plastics, with performance advantages in areas such as tensile strength and oxygen or water vapour permeability. An agricultural mulch film that biodegrades in the field, removing the need for spring collection, has been tested on research crops at UBC.

Bioform's approach is built around repurposing existing pulp and paper machinery to make its films at volume, and supplying roll-stock that substitutes for plastic films in existing thermoforming and heat-sealing equipment with minimal modification.

Founding story

Bioform's core technology originated at the University of British Columbia, where co-founder Jordan MacKenzie developed the process as a postdoctoral fellow and later research associate in the lab of Mark Martinez, a professor of chemical and biological engineering, Bio-Products Institute member and former director of UBC's Pulp and Paper Centre, who is also a co-founder. The underlying research addressed a fluid dynamics problem of layering two fluids and flowing them at high speed without mixing, a solution that proved applicable to manufacturing plastic alternatives. The company was founded in 2021.

Business model

Bioform develops and manufactures bio-based film materials intended to be supplied as roll-stock that replaces conventional plastic films in customers' existing thermoforming and heat-sealing production lines. Manufacturing is designed around repurposing existing pulp and paper machinery rather than building new plastic-conversion infrastructure.

Latest developments

In April 2024 Suzano Ventures, the corporate venture arm of Brazilian pulp producer Suzano, announced an investment of up to US$5 million in Bioform, reported as a $5 million seed round, to fund development, a pilot demonstration facility and team expansion.

Market position

Bioform positions itself among startups seeking to replace single-use plastics with renewable materials, with the stated aim of matching conventional plastics on performance, processing speed and cost β€” producing at "the speed of paper and at the cost of plastic" β€” and claims no green premium relative to conventional plastic. Press coverage groups it with other sustainable-materials companies such as Sparxell and Traceless Materials.

History

Founded in 2021 as a UBC spin-out, Bioform participated in the HATCH Venture Builder program at UBC's Institute for Computing, Information and Cognitive Systems, and as of April 2023 planned to move into its own commercial space. It was named a finalist for the 2022 Ocean Changemaker Challenge. In April 2024 Suzano Ventures announced an investment of up to US$5 million to accelerate development of the company's bio-based plastic alternatives, build a demonstration facility to pilot the manufacturing process, and expand the team.
